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Leyte Plumed-Warbler | Maclaud's Horseshoe Bat |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Passeriformes (Songbirds) | Chiroptera (Bats) |
| Family | Timaliidae | Rhinolophidae |
| Genus | Micromacronus | Rhinolophus |
| Species | Micromacronus leytensis | Rhinolophus maclaudi |
